Skip to content


Remove the first occurrence of a pointer from the list.


Source position: line 331

  function Extract(item: Pointer) : Pointer;


Extract searched for an occurrence of item, and if a match is found, the match is deleted from the list. If no match is found, nothing is deleted. If Item was found, the result is Item. If Item was not found, the result is Nil. A lnExtracted notification event is triggered if an element is extracted from the list.

See also

Name Description
TList.Delete Removes a pointer from the list.
TList.IndexOf Returns the index of a given pointer.
TList.Remove Removes a value from the list.